Finance: Property & Casualty Insurance Industry News Posted on Jun 2, 2009 (30 days ago) HARTFORD, Conn.----Travelers today announced the launch of its International Coverage Extensions for Commercial Accounts, Travelers mid-sized business customers. The new coverage extensions provide liability protection for worldwide situations resulting from U.S. exported products or temporary business travel outside the U.S. and Canada, as well as coverage for business personal property located abroad. Dow boots GM & Citigroup for 2 healthier blue chipsNew York Daily News, NYCitigroup was formed in 1998 from the merger of Travelers Group and Citicorp. In 2002, Citigroup gave up control of Hartford, Conn.-based Travelers Property Casualty through an initial public offering and subsequent spinoff.Reuters. |
